Unidentified Hispanic Male
* The victim was discovered on February 23, 1982 in Hanover County, Virginia
* Estimated Date of Death: 3 months prior
* Manner of Death: He had been shot several times in the head and chest.
Vital Statistics
* Estimated age: 25-45 years old
* Approximate Height and Weight: 5'6"; 190-195 lbs.
* Distinguishing Characteristics: Likely of South American origin. Dark brown, short hair, balding. Stocky build. He was missing his appendix & gall. An old scar, with unknown cause for surgery, of right anterior hip. Tattoos if present could not be identified. No beard or mustache.
* Clothing: He was wearing a thick, white knit ski sweater, with gray and red horizontal band across the mid chest over a baby blue t-shirt that reads, "Someone went to Florida and all I got was this lousy T-shirt." A pair of new, tan cowboy boots and brown support socks.
* Jewelry: He was wearing an 18 carat gold crucifix on gold chain and a Seiko watch with the dates in English and Spanish. The watch had been sold outside the United States, and never been turned in for repairs. The name Lucy and the date 4-14-75 are on his wedding band.
* Dentals: Available. A gold crown. Teeth are in good repair.
* Fingerprints: Some prints recovered.

Case History
The victim was located in a thicket on the side of Interstate 95, north of Doswell in Hanover County, Virginia on February 23, 1982.
